Posted:
Last Online:  
 

Catt@sc4d, Thank you greatfully.

I need HELP in a few questions, if you may:

1. The Landmarks are beeing installed automatically in the Programs/Maxis/Plugins folders.

Will they still be operational if I CUT and PASTE them in MyDocs/Simcity4/Plugins in a NEW folder of mine, in order to manage better my plugins folders?

2. Some of the Landmarks .DAT, when download, lose their NAME and appeared just as PLUGIN. I had to MODIFY their NAMES (Example: "ArcTriomphe" was just called PLUGIN) so I could manage the dowloads and instalation of the Landmarks. Is there a problem changing the Landmarks .DAT names for a more eficient organization of the plugins?

3. Some files like "America Flag Props", are just a .DAT file, contrary to others Landmarks that are .EXE (aplications).

Is "American Flag Props" and others not part of the Maxis LANDMARKS, or are they?

Are they part of another group of MAXIS downloads?

In what Plugin folder should I put these files (not .EXE, just .DAT)? MyDocs/...plugins or Programs/Maxis...plugins?

Can I just put them in a MyDocs/Simcity 4/plugins folder created by me?

Thanks

1. Yes.

2. The file name doesn't matter. All plugins are identified internally.

3. When a file shows up as a props file, it is actually that. It is for use by the Lot Editor to place decorations on a lot. They should be in your plugins file.

However, something worth noting. The game is set up for multiple users on the same machine. If permissions are set correctly on the Program Files section, any user can access the game. Simply launching the game it sets up the user area files including the defaults and an empty plugins folder. Maxis has sent the landmarks to the base files of the system which means that anyone who starts the game gets them.

By moving them, you disable the multi-user features intended by Maxis. Frankly, I would leave them in their default locations. This way, if you create a special purpose ID to run something like Sim Mars, you will still have them.

Some people never realize that most operating systems these days support multiple users. This causes all kinds of angst when a common account is used by several persons (in a family for example). If everyone has his own account, password protected, then no one not having admin permissions can disturb other users files.

So, perhaps it is not smart to change the destination of supplied plugins from Maxis. There usually is a reason to be unselfish.

Posted:
Last Online:  
 

The official name of Namdaemun is Sungnyemun (the name used in the game), which is one of the SC4 landmarks. It is one of the Maxis files that comes as an installer, not a .dat, so it will need to be run to install it. When the installer is run, the .dat file is placed in the Program Files plugins folder, but can be moved to the My Documents plugins.

Note: The installed .dat file is named "NamDaeMoon"- don't know why... :???:

Posted:
Last Online:  
 

Good evening to you all. I'm new here and I come see you. Problem for a personal encounter with sim city4. Since the installation of several pack for SIM CITY 4. Including the famous NAM. I lost the exchanger access to highways on the ground. How to retrieve? Cordially.

Ps: Also, I am having problems of creation of exchanger. With normal highways. That will create three access ramps, in correspondence with a road. But with an avenue, it's four branch.

Share this post


Link to post
Share on other sites
Posted:
Last Online:  
 

If, by 'exchanger' you mean traffic interchange is sounds like you are having conflicts within your Plugin suite. I suggest you proceed as follows:

  • Rename your folder <user>/Documents/SimCity 4 Deluxe/Plugins to Plugins.old and start the game. This has the effect of creating an empty Plugins folder. Shut the game down.
  • Reinstall the NAM in the new folder (just use the installation .exe).
  • Start your game and check for the interchanges that have disappeared. They should all be there at this point.
  • You now have the onerous duty of adding back each of your old plugins one at a time until you find the one that causes the problem. When you find it, remove it and put all the rest back in your plugins suite.

I hope this helps.

Posted:
Last Online:  
 

my pc decided to die on me and had to re install simcity 4..since its been so long, do i need ep1 update and ep2 update? i don't remember..can someone point me in the right direction..its been so long

Share this post


Link to post
Share on other sites
Posted:
Last Online:  
 

Yes, EP1-Update-1 and the BAT update will be needed unless you already have the updated version (1.1.640).

EP1-Update-1 : https://www.sc4devotion.com/forums/index.php?page=16

8bwQx.png

There are some files there, choose the version that match with your version !

The BAT Update : https://www.sc4devotion.com/forums/index.php?page=14

Scroll down, you will see the link to download the BAT Update.
